BMC11048E <ddname>, key size does not match that defined for this data set.
<bcssid>
Explanation: The key length defined for the specified registration data set is not
correct. The key length is predetermined and cannot be altered from the length
defined during installation. <ddname> indicates the DD statement associated with
the registration data set.
System Action: The registration data set is closed and other processing bypassed.
User Response: Use IDCAMS to delete and redefine the registration data set with
the key length specified during installation.
BMC11049E <ddname>, relative key position does not match that defined for this
dataset. <bcssid>
Explanation: The relative key position (key offset) for the specified registration
data set is not correct. The starting key position is predetermined and cannot be
altered from that defined during installation. <ddname> indicates the DD statement
associated with the registration data set.
System Action: The registration data set is closed and other processing bypassed.
User Response: Use IDCAMS to delete and redefine the registration data set with
the relative key position specified during installation.
BMC11050S <ddname>, ACB OPEN FAILED, R15(<returncode>),
ACBERFLG(<errorflag>), {INITIAL | FINAL}. <bcssid>
Explanation: An attempt to open the ACB of a registration data set was not
successful. The IEC16I messages are issued by the MVS operating system.
<ddname> indicates the DD statement associated with the registration data set.
<returncode> indicates the generated return code. <errorflag> indicates the
generated ACB error flag.
System Action: Processing of the registration data set is bypassed.
User Response: Consult the IBM documentation for an explanation of message
IEC161, and resolve the problem with the cluster. If the problem cannot be resolved,
consult BMC Software Product Support.
